A systems technician is configuring hardware components for laptop, desktop, and server deployments. Match each RAM form factor or technical specification on the left with its primary physical characteristic or operational requirement on the right.
- SO-DIMM Form FactorCompact physical footprint engineered specifically for laptops and small-form-factor systems
- ECC (Error-Correcting Code) MemoryUses a 72-bit bus width to detect and correct single-bit memory errors in critical enterprise servers
- Dual-Channel ArchitectureRequires populating matching RAM modules in designated, color-coded motherboard slots to double bandwidth
- DDR5 PMIC IntegrationMoves voltage regulation and power management functionality from the motherboard directly onto the RAM module
Answer
SO-DIMM Form Factor pairs with the compact physical footprint for mobile/laptop devices; ECC Memory pairs with the 72-bit bus width for detecting and correcting single-bit server errors; Dual-Channel Architecture pairs with populating matching modules in designated motherboard slots; DDR5 PMIC Integration pairs with onboard voltage regulation on the memory module.
Each RAM specification directly corresponds to its design requirement: SO-DIMMs accommodate space-constrained laptops, ECC uses a 72-bit bus width for error correction, dual-channel requires matching paired slots for double bandwidth, and DDR5 PMIC shifts power management directly onto the RAM module.
